New e-Sourcing 5.0 Install - Error checking JDBC Driver version

Hi  All,
I am currently attempting to install an e-Sourcing 5.0 Patch Level E instance on a Windows system using Oracle 10.2.0.3 and WebLogic 8.1 SP4.  e-Sourcing's installation and configuration complete without issue.  The schema in the database is loaded with the e-Sourcing tables and data.
However, when attempting to deploy the ear file via WebLogic, I receive the following JDBC error:
Error checking JDBC Driver version. Detail: Error: found unsupported JDBC Driver name: Oracle JDBC driver version: 10.1.0.2.0.
The JDBC driver in use is from  my Oracle install ..\oracle\product\10.2.0\db_1\jdbc\lib\ojdbc14.jar
I've also tried classes12.jar for versions 9.2.0.8, 10.1.0.2, and 10.2.0.1 but always receive the same error (...driver version: 10.1.0.2.0...) message regardless of the version of driver I am using.

The issue is still occurring.
The Supported Platform documentation indicates that the Oracle JDBC thin driver 10.2.0.1.0 is the supported driver.  I have tried both the Classes12.jar and ojdbc14.jar for this version of driver.
What is odd about this error is that it always displays the same message and version #, no matter what version of driver I use.
"found unsupported JDBC Driver name: Oracle JDBC driver version: 10.1.0.2.0"  (I execute setup and configuration each time I use a different driver to ensure the ear file is updated)
I have also tried using a different Driver Class path.  The installation guides for 5.0 and 5.1 indicate Driver Class as oracle.jdbc.driver.OracleDriver.  I have also tried oracle.jdbc.OracleDriver for a few of the versions with no success.  I still receive the same error at the same point.

    I am using NetBeans IDE and have created a database under: Services->Databases-> Java DB->SimpleDBDemo.
    I have a database connection in which theres a simple table (called "TABLE1") created which contains the names and ages of two people. I am trying to access the data of these two people.
    From what i can figure out i am getting a runtime error. I have downloaded a folder called "Microsoft SQL Driver 2005 JDBC Driver" which contains the "sqljdbc.jar" executable file. I copied the jar file to the library in "Program files->Sun->javadb" and then added the file to the project libraries section i.e. "Project->properties->add JAR/Folder->sqljdbc.jar" in netbeans.
    I am still getting the same runtime error. Have i the sqljdbc.jar file added in the wrong place?
    Any help would be greatly appreciated.

    Microsoft SQL Driver 2005 JDBC Driver is not the Derby driver.
    You need the correct JDBC driver for the database you are using, you can't simply grab the first one you find.

    Hi,
    Rocío Lorena Suárez wrote:
    NWMss  SQLServer JDBC Driver  Syntax error at token 0, line 0 offset 0
    I think that you may be trying to construct an SQL query using some logic. Is that right?
    I hav encountered this problem when trying these types of code - If possible please debug the code and see if there is any particular case in which the SQL string in which the command is saved becomes null.
    When it is null or blank - the SQL Driver will throw such an error.
